void MusicWheel::SortSongPointerArrayBySectionName( vector<Song*> &arraySongPointers, SongSortOrder so )
{
for(unsigned i = 0; i < arraySongPointers.size(); ++i)
{
CString val = MusicWheel::GetSectionNameFromSongAndSort( arraySongPointers[i], so );
/* Make sure NUM comes first and OTHER comes last. */
if( val == "NUM" ) val = "0";
else if( val == "OTHER" ) val = "2";
else val = "1" + val;
song_sort_val[arraySongPointers[i]] = val;
}
stable_sort( arraySongPointers.begin(), arraySongPointers.end(), CompareSongPointersBySortVal );
song_sort_val.clear();
}
